Nano-Sized Composite Particle Preparation by a Micro-Fluidic System

Abstract
Low toxicity and air-stable single molecular source for ZnS was demonstrated to be an appropriate reagent to synthesize high luminescent ZnS capped CdSe with narrow size distribution. Above 50% quantum yield and around 32 nm full width at half maximum of photoluminescence peak were obtainable using microreactor. Hydrophilic surface of ZnS capped CdSe nanocrystals can be realized while keeping high quantum yield. Microscopic observation showed that accurate time control is important to avoid the appearance of a great deal of isolated ZnS particles and deterioration of luminescent properties, and microreactor exhibited the great advantage on this control.
